Two distinguished students win For Our Future Scholarship

20 May 2022

Michael Chong, a Year 3 student of the Department of English Language and Literature, and Yeung Wing-kwan, a Year 3 student of the Department of Government and International Studies, are among the 16 awardees in Hong Kong who were each awarded a scholarship of HK$50,000 under the For Our Future Scholarship 2021-2022 scheme.

Michael enjoys English public speaking, and he loves sharing his latest adventures. In particular, he documents his English learning journey, favourite sports activities, campus life and cross-cultural interaction experiences on social media platforms such as YouTube and Bilibili, and his videos have attracted several thousand viewers.

With the goal of being a young leader, Wing-kwan has been actively equipping herself with the necessary expertise, and she hopes to use her knowledge and skills in public policy and the international arena.

The For Our Future Scholarship has been offered by the Greater Bay Area Homeland Youth Community Foundation to local students since 2020 in recognition of their outstanding academic achievements, personal development and contributions to society.
